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
409033600 59715 0770
8507722 43288257326
8507722 43288257326
768696 19401 66237315835
All about undefined
Interested in learning more?
8507722 43288257326
768696 19401 66237315835
See more
557661 024 92
829 79150798 415190 1020562695 11209
See more
7508 859
9743024 51744591 4534
See more